C. David "Dave" Ostrander, 81, of Owego, New York, passed away Tuesday, September 16, 2025, at home. David was born in Sidney, New York to the late Charles E. and Lillian A. (Jackson) Ostrander. Along with his parents, David was predeceased by his first wife of 44 years, Beth Ann (Bently) Ostrander. David is survived by his current wife, Carol A. Meyers Livermore Ostrander; his sister, Kathryn Ostrander; brother and sister-in-law, Gary and Marcia Ostrander; stepdaughters and their husbands, Rachel and Brooks Moses, Caroline and Daniel Layman; four grandchildren, Xavier, Rosalyn, Benjamin, Theodore; several nieces, nephews and extended family and friends. During WWII, David's father served in the U.S. Navy, as a result David, as an infant, moved to his grandparent's farm with his mother and was raised working on the farms in the Newark Valley area. In 1962, he graduated from Newark Valley High School, 1965, from Broome Technical Community College (Engineering Physics), 1968, from State University College – Cortland (BS – Physics), 1972, from State University College – Geneseo (MS – Science Education). In 1968, David started teaching Math and Physics at Owego Free Academy, until his retirement in 2004. He was active with the Owego United Methodist Church, the Tioga County Historical Society, American Red Cross Blood Drives, Tioga Relay for Life (Cancer), Tioga County Senior Citizen Board, Tioga County Election Inspector, Ye Olde Country Florist, and co-owned with his wife, Carol, Carol's Coffee and Art Bar. David took great pride with the upkeep of his yard and enjoyed gardening. David enjoyed supporting the grandchildren's sporting and special events. He will be remembered for his kind spirit and love of the Lord.
